What does the word "Snaily" mean?

The word "Snaily" might not be commonly found in standard dictionaries, but its usage has emerged in various conversations, especially in online communities and social media. It is often considered a playful, informal term that evokes imagery associated with slowness, sluggishness, or perhaps a particular attitude towards leisure and relaxation.

One of the most prominent associations with the term "Snaily" relates to the depiction of snails, which are known for their slow movement. This connection brings forth a variety of interpretations:

In some circles, "Snaily" is also used humorously to describe someone who appears to be moving slowly, whether that’s due to procrastination or simply taking their time to complete a task. For example, a student who is known for submitting assignments later than peers might be affectionately dubbed "Snaily" by friends.

Additionally, "Snaily" has been absorbed into memes and visual culture, where it often represents a humorous caricature of slothfulness. With the rise of internet culture, this playful term has found a space in the lexicon of younger generations who appreciate humor in the absurdity of everyday life.

In the context of pets, especially when referring to snails as companions in a pet aquarium or garden, "Snaily" is often used affectionately. It can describe their personality traits, such as being gentle, easygoing, or surprisingly engaging for a creature often overlooked.

As language evolves, the meaning of "Snaily" continues to adapt, reflecting the nuances of modern communication. Whether it is used to describe a laid-back attitude, a quirky personality, or just a relatable moment of slowness, the term encapsulates a playful aspect of human experience. Embracing the "Snaily" side of life often reminds us of the virtues of patience and the importance of slowing down to appreciate the little things. In a fast-paced world, perhaps we can all find some value in being a little more "Snaily."
